Appearing Rooms is an interactive sculpture by the Danish artist Jeppe Hein, which was installed in Preston’s market square for six weeks during the summer of 2006. The sculpture radically transformed the nature of the space from a short-cut to other destinations, to a place in which people chose to spend time and interact. Appearing Rooms was especially popular with families, many of whom travelled from outside of Preston to visit the work, often armed with towels and swimming costumes!
